Choosing the Perfect Material
The material of a blanket is crucial when considering both comfort and décor impact. Cashmere blankets, for instance, are celebrated for their soft, lightweight texture, making them perfect for draping elegantly across a sofa or armchair. Wool blankets, on the other hand, provide a rustic yet refined look, offering warmth and durability that make them ideal for colder climates or cozying up by the fireplace.
Cotton blankets strike a balance between softness and breathability, making them versatile for year-round use. Their natural fibers lend themselves well to layering, allowing you to combine different patterns and textures without overwhelming the space. For those who enjoy the luxurious feel of a velvet or chenille throw, these materials add a touch of opulence and glamour, making them perfect for modern or eclectic interiors.

Caring for Your Blankets
To ensure that your blankets remain both beautiful and functional, proper care is essential. Different materials require different cleaning methods. Wool and cashmere blankets often benefit from gentle hand washing or dry cleaning, while cotton and synthetic fabrics are typically machine washable. Regular care helps maintain the softness and appearance of your blankets, extending their life and keeping your home décor looking fresh.
Additionally, storing blankets properly when not in use is important. Folding them neatly or storing them in breathable baskets prevents damage and keeps them ready for cozy evenings. With the right care, your blankets can become long-lasting additions to your chic home décor.
